เผื่อใครยังไม่รู้ หากคุณมีปัญหาพื้นที่บนเครื่องเต็ม ต้องคอยนั่งลบ node_modules เอง วันนี้ผมขอนำเสนอวิธีง่ายๆ ครับ ด้วยการใช้ npkill
การใช้งาน
เราสามารถรันได้ 2 วิธีครับ คือ
- ติดตั้งแบบ Global ด้วยคำสั่ง
npm install -g npkill - รันด้วยการใช้
npx npkill
วิธีการใช้งาน ก็แสนง่าย เข้าไปที่โฟลเดอร์หลัก ที่เราต้องการให้มัน scan หา จากนั้น ก็รันคำสั่งได้เลย
npkill
# หรือแบบ npx
npx npkill
สามารถเลือก และกด Space bar เพื่อลบได้เลย
ตัวอย่างการใช้งานอื่นๆ
- ค้นหา
node_modulesที่โฟลเดอร์ projects และไม่เอาพวก hidden files
npkill -d ~/projects -x- แสดงสีที่เราต้องการ
npkill --color green- ค้นหาและทำการเรียงลำดับตามขนาด node_modules
npkill -s size- Authors
-
Chai Phonbopit
Senior Software Engineer ประสบการณ์กว่า 12 ปี ด้าน Frontend: React, Next.js, Tailwind CSS และ Backend: Node.js, Express, NestJS ปัจจุบันสนใจ Astro, Cloudflare Workers และ AI Coding Tool